[dpdk-dev] [PATCH] mem: fix overflowed return value
Fix issue reported by Coverity. Coverity ID 13255: Overflowed return value: The return value will be too small or even negative, likely resulting in unexpected behavior in a caller that uses the return value. In rte_mem_virt2phy: An integer overflow occurs, with the overflowed value used as the return value of the function Fixes: 3097de6e6bfb ("mem: get physical address of any pointer") Signed-off-by: Michal Kobylinski --- lib/librte_eal/linuxapp/eal/eal_memory.c | 2 +- 1 file changed, 1 insertion(+), 1 deletion(-) diff --git a/lib/librte_eal/linuxapp/eal/eal_memory.c b/lib/librte_eal/linuxapp/eal/eal_memory.c index 5b9132c..6ceca5b 100644 --- a/lib/librte_eal/linuxapp/eal/eal_memory.c +++ b/lib/librte_eal/linuxapp/eal/eal_memory.c @@ -195,7 +195,7 @@ rte_mem_virt2phy(const void *virtaddr) * the pfn (page frame number) are bits 0-54 (see * pagemap.txt in linux Documentation) */ - physaddr = ((page & 0x7fULL) * page_size) + physaddr = (uint64_t)((page & 0x7fULL) * page_size) + ((unsigned long)virtaddr % page_size); close(fd); return physaddr; -- 1.9.1
